Bio

Born in rural Lafayette Parish, Louisiana with a Rayne, Louisiana address less then a mile south east of Acadia/Lafayette Parish(County) line in 1937. I'm told it was a raining that day and my Dad had to rush into Rayne about 3 miles away in horse drawn buggy, on muddy gravel road to alert the doctor. When he arrived at Dr. Faulk's office, he was told that the Dr. had been called out in our neck of the woods and they would get the message to him. This was before telephones were being used in rural areas so the Dr. had to return to town to get the message.

When I was about 4 years old, we moved to Acadia parish on the south east corner of what is now Leroy Breaux Road at Standard Mill Road where Dad became a farm hand for Clebert "Barro" Breaux. After Clebert's death, his son Davis took over the farm and we moved into the Clebert home where Dad tended the farm. By then I had a brother Gerald 6 and sister Joanne 5, and brother Lesley Dale was born later that year(1949) after we had moved in.

I started 1st grade at St. Joseph Catholic School but graduated from Rayne High, public school in 1958 and went to work for Mervine Kahn Co. as a hardware clerk from 58-59, W.A Kennedy as a grocery clerk from 59-63. Married Gloria Ann Moore in 1961 while working for Kennedy and in 1963 we moved to Groves,Texas to work for Market Basket Food Store.

Gloria and I had 3 children, Danny, Shannon and Anna. Gloria passed away in 2004 and in 2006 I moved back to Louisiana where I married high school sweetheart Julia Falcon-LaCroix.
